The Fusion360 free-tier has been getting ever more restrictive over time. At the moment it is at:
> users who generate less than $1,000 USD in annual revenue and use for home-based, non-commercial projects only.
Which already makes it unsuitable for any Open Source work. While one might still accept those restrictions for quick one-off projects, those projects are also the ones that FreeCAD can handle fine.
